摘要

Wavelet technology is applied to direct the traffic of Olympic Games to locate and identify various vehicles. License plate recognition algorithm is always on the basis of Fourier transform theory. However, when expressing signal through Fourier, all frequencies it contains can be determined but when they appear cannot be determined. Apply wavelet transform theory to the whole process of license plate recognition, and give a comparison between wavelet and Fourier transform after a deep research on the theory of wavelet for the further applications in solving the anti-jamming problems of license plate recognition.
